星际航行游戏流程(Unity 初学者)

  • 第一节 创建工程

1、创建3D项目工程
创建一个文件夹,命名为_Scene
新建场景,然后保存【CTRL+S】,将其命名为myscene
2、设置游戏窗口的大小 400*600
选择文件菜单,单击Build settings
3、拖动飞船模型进入层级视图,重置其transform属性 重命名为Player
4、添加刚体组件
5、取消使用重力选项
6、为飞船添加网格碰撞体
7、勾选 Convex、IS Trigger
8、更换Mesh编辑框中的内容
使用更为简单的模型来替换,便于在碰撞检测时节约资源
使用vehicle_playership_collider
替换网格碰撞体中的Mesh编辑框中的内容

  • 第二节 添加尾焰

9、为飞船添加尾部火焰效果
火焰效果使用的是粒子系统的预制体
10、在预制体资源文件夹中找到engines_player
预制体拖动到层级视图中的Player上,使其成为飞船的子对象;
11、调整摄像机的参数
12、将摄像机属性的Rotation X设置为90
position调整为(0,10,5)
13、设置摄像机属性 Clear Flags为 Solid Color
设置摄像机投影属性Projection为正交投影
设置摄像机Size属性为10

- 第三节 添加星空背景

14、添加星空背景
15、拖动预制体StarField到层级视图中
调整属性参数:
16、创建Quad平面 重置transform属性;(Reset),重命名为Background,更改其Rotation属性 (90,0,0)
17、选择Textures目录下的图片tile_nebula_green_dff
拖动其到Background之上;
更改其Scale的x 15 y 30
18、更改星空背景的position属性,将其y值

你可能感兴趣的:(U3D)